Covid as Medicare
The objective was to criticize Trump for his actions in managing US debt. But that’s when the problem started. Biden mistakenly said there are a thousand billionaires in America, before correcting it to “billionaires.”
So he struggled to formulate a long comment for health care. Meaning “Medicare,” he said Covid and ended with the unintelligible “we finally beat Medicare.”
Borders (language does not have)
Biden failed to clearly articulate his immigration policy proposal. He began by saying that there were 40 percent fewer people crossing the border illegally under his watch before ending by saying he would work to ban “comprehensive initiative in terms of what we’re going to do with more border patrols and more asylum officers”.
Abortion (Roe vs Wade)
Biden tried to attack Trump for appointing conservative justices to the Supreme Court and later overturning the court’s landmark Roe v. Wade decision (constitutional protections for abortion).
Biden tried to describe the legal framework for deciding third-trimester pregnancy, but it all turned into a confusing explanation: “The first time is between a woman and a doctor. The second time is between the doctor and an extreme situation. And a third time is between the doctor – I mean, it should be between her and the stateIt is”.
